Niles iC2
$999.00
Released February, 2008
The Pros:Can control anything. Easy to use - big buttons and simple interface. Single 'Off' button turns the entire system off.
The Cons:Expensive. Requires professional installation. Very disappointed in battery life and the need to constantly plug in and recharge.
The Niles iC2 is an advanced home theater automation and control system that focuses on an easy to use interface and requires little maintenance once it's been set up. The iC2 is usually installed by a professional, although the remote itself is very simple.
The big buttons and one-touch option are there so that anyone in the family (including kids) can easily use the remote. The entire system includes the wireless remote as well as a main system unit (called the HT-MSU) that sits with your home theater.
Features
- Rechargeable lithium ion battery
- Ergonomic design
- Backlit for operation in low light
- Control the system through IR or RS-232
- Flash memory
- 75 to 100 feet range

Specifications
- RF frequency: 2.4GHz
- IR bandwidth frequencies: between 26 and 105KHz
- 8 RS232 ports
- 8 IR ports
- Dimensions (remote): 7.5" L X 5.2" W X 3" H
- Dimensions (HT-MSU): 10.5" L X 6" W X 1" H
